英文摘要
This research deals with a Fuel Cell(FC) generation system with a reformer for home appliances. The proposed FC generation system is with an EDLC. The EDLC stores the power generated from FC when the load in a house is changed from heavy to light conditions. The EDLC supplies power to the load when the load is changed from light to heavy conditions. So the proposed FC generation system can compensate the oversupply and shortage power from the FC. A current balancer operation is added to the power conditioner. This balancer operation improves the efficiency of the pole mounted distribution transformer. A variable capacity capacitor simulator with an inner resistor is also proposed. A proto type laboratory model is constructed and tested. Detail evaluations of the constructed mode and economical review are an important issue for further study.
